| Two days ago with dancing glancing hair | B |
| With living lips and eyes | C |
| Now pale dumb blind she lies | C |
| So pale yet still so fair | B |
| - | |
| We have not left her yet not yet alone | D |
| But soon must leave her where | B |
| She will not miss our care | B |
| Bone of our bone | D |
| - | |
| Weep not O friends we should not weep | E |
| Our friend of friends lies full of rest | F |
| No sorrow rankles in her breast | F |
| Fallen fast asleep | E |
| - | |
| She sleeps below | G |
| She wakes and laughs above | H |
| To day as she walked let us walk in love | H |
| To morrow follow so | G |
Christina Georgina Rossetti
